Ukusila ngeCylindrical
Ukugaya nge-cylindrical (okubizwa ngokuba yi-center-type grinding) kusetyenziselwa ukugawula imiphezulu ye-cylindrical kunye namagxa e-workpiece. I-workpiece ifakwe kwiziko kwaye ijikeleziswa sisixhobo esaziwa ngokuba yi-center driver. Ivili elirhabaxa kunye ne-workpiece zijikeleziswa ziimoto ezahlukeneyo kwaye ngesantya esahlukileyo. Itafile ingalungiswa ukuze ivelise ii-tapers. Intloko yevili ingajikeleziswa. Iintlobo ezintlanu zokugaya nge-cylindrical zezi: ukugaya nge-outside diameter (OD), ukugaya nge-inside diameter (ID), ukugaya nge-plunge, ukugaya nge-creep feed, kunye nokugaya ngaphandle kwe-centerless.
Ububanzi bokuGcada ngaphandle
Ukusila kwe-OD kukusila okwenzeka kumphezulu wangaphandle wento ephakathi kweziko. Iziko ziiyunithi zokugqibela ezinenqaku elivumela into ukuba ijikeleziswe. Ivili lokusila nalo lijikeleziswa kwicala elifanayo xa lidibana nento. Oku kuthetha ukuba ezi ndawo zimbini ziya kuhamba kwicala elichaseneyo xa kudityaniswa into, nto leyo evumela ukusebenza kakuhle kwaye amathuba okuxinana anciphe.
Ububanzi bokuGcada ngaphakathi
Ukusila nge-ID kukusila okwenzeka ngaphakathi kwento. Ivili lokusila lihlala lincinci kunobubanzi bento. Into ibanjwe endaweni yi-collet, ekwajikeleza into endaweni yayo. Kanye njengokuba kunjalo ngokusila nge-OD, ivili lokusila kunye nento zijikeleza kwicala elahlukileyo zinika unxibelelwano olubuyela umva lweendawo ezimbini apho ukusila kwenzeka khona.
Ukunyamezelana kokugaya okusilinda kugcinwe ngaphakathi kwe-±0.0005 intshi (13 μm) yobubanzi kunye ne-±0.0001 intshi (2.5 μm) yokujikeleza. Umsebenzi ochanekileyo unokufikelela kumlinganiselo ofikelela kwi-±0.00005 intshi (1.3 μm) yobubanzi kunye ne-±0.00001 intshi (0.25 μm) yokujikeleza. Ukugqitywa komphezulu kunokuqala kwi-2 microinches (51 nm) ukuya kwi-125 microinches (3.2 μm), kunye nokugqitywa okuqhelekileyo ukusuka kwi-8 ukuya kwi-32 microinches (0.20 ukuya kwi-0.81 μm)
